Jon RezinAPI Docs

API công khai của Jon Rezin

Truy cập đọc công khai, thân thiện với agent vào tiểu sử, dịch vụ, discography, nghệ sĩ và các bản tóm tắt trang có cấu trúc của Jon — cộng với biểu mẫu tiếp nhận yêu cầu. Spec: /openapi.json (OpenAPI 3.1).

Trợ lý AI: trang này quảng bá một máy chủ Model Context Protocol tại /.well-known/mcp.json. Hai công cụ chỉ đọc khả dụng qua JSON-RPC 2.0 tại /api/v1/mcp: getCredits(artist)searchReleases(query).

Bio

Tiểu sử có cấu trúc, dịch vụ, giải thưởng và tình trạng nhận dự án hiện tại.

curl https://jonrezin.com/api/v1/jon.json

Discography

Lọc theo nghệ sĩ hoặc vai trò; phân trang qua limit + offset.

curl 'https://jonrezin.com/api/v1/discography?artist=Bad%20Bunny&limit=10'

Tóm tắt trang (theo ngôn ngữ)

Schema.org WebPage cho bất kỳ URL nào đã biết; ?lang=<code> trả về tiêu đề/mô tả đã dịch.

curl 'https://jonrezin.com/api/v1/page.json?url=/about&lang=de'

Sitemap JSON

Mọi URL công khai kèm ngôn ngữ + loại. Cache trong 1 giờ.

curl https://jonrezin.com/api/v1/sitemap.json

MCP — liệt kê công cụ

JSON-RPC 2.0 qua HTTP. Không cần xác thực.

curl -X POST https://jonrezin.com/api/v1/mcp \
  -H 'Content-Type: application/json' \
  -d '{"jsonrpc":"2.0","id":1,"method":"tools/list"}'

MCP — getCredits

Trả về các credit của Jon cho nghệ sĩ được chỉ định.

curl -X POST https://jonrezin.com/api/v1/mcp \
  -H 'Content-Type: application/json' \
  -d '{"jsonrpc":"2.0","id":2,"method":"tools/call",
       "params":{"name":"getCredits","arguments":{"artist":"Bad Bunny"}}}'

Rate limit: 60 req/hr per IP. Identify as an agent via User-Agent: YourBot/1.0 (on-behalf-of: [email protected]) for 300 req/hr. Full agent policy: /ai.txt.